Outpost24 Expands Global Presence, New Office in the United States

03-09-2009 09:34 PM CET | IT, New Media & Software

Press release from: Outpost24 AB

Outpost24 Expands Global Presence, New Office in the United

Internationally recognized Security Expert, Robert E. Lee to head up US push.

KARLSKRONA, Sweden – March 9, 2009 – Outpost24, the Technology Leader in On-Demand Vulnerability Management solutions, today announced that it has opened a new office in Salt Lake City, Utah. Outpost24 is a well established global player, with dedicated sales offices in 25 countries.

Outpost24’s move into the United States reinforces its global leadership position in Vulnerability Management. Targeting the Salt Lake City region is in keeping with the objective to provide customers with local support and service. Robert E. Lee of Outpost24 was quoted as saying:

“The US market is one of the most well established and competitive arenas for Information Security providers. Outpost24 is very excited to now have a local presence to serve our customers in the US.”

Robert E. Lee is a 17 year veteran of IT with a career focus of Security, High Availability, and Disaster Recovery. Robert serves as Director of Projects and Resources for the non-profit Institute for Security and Open Methodologies (ISECOM) and is very active in the Information Security community and a popular speaker at security conferences worldwide.

About Outpost24:
Outpost24 is the European leader in on-demand vulnerability assessment and management solutions with over 1,000 corporate and government customers, including Travelex, Delta Lloyd Group, ING Life Limited, University of Helsinki, and Deloitte. Outpost24 is headquartered in Sweden with a global network of local sales offices.

Outpost24 delivers security solutions in a Software-as-a-Service (OUTSCAN® & OUTSCAN PCI®) or Appliance (HIAB®) form factor. Outpost24’s solutions provide fully automated network vulnerability scanning, easily interpreted reports, and vulnerability management tools. OUTSCAN PCI® is the ideal tool for businesses of all sizes to achieve and demonstrate PCI DSS compliance.

Outpost24’s solutions can be deployed in a matter of hours, anywhere in the world, providing customers an immediate view of their security and compliance posture. OUTSCAN® is the most widely deployed On-Demand security solution in Europe, performing scans for over 1000 customers last year.
